Noneconomic Damages
Compensation awarded in a lawsuit for losses that do not have a direct monetary value, such as pain and suffering, loss of companionship, or emotional distress.
Negligence
The failure to take reasonable care to avoid causing injury or loss to another person, resulting in legal liability.
Disclaimer
A term in a contract whereby a party attempts to relieve itself of some potential liability associated with the contract. The most common example is the seller’s attempt to disclaim liability for defects in goods that it sells.
Recovery
The act of obtaining something of value through legal means, often in compensation for damages or loss.
